Job description

Being a Support Worker with Protective Care Group is a meaningful and extremely important job. We specialise in providing a level of support that local authorities are often unable to; support that makes a real difference to young people’s quality of life and prospects.

You will be working directly with some of the most vulnerable, at risk young people in the UK and as part of a team, you’ll help deliver a bespoke and tailor-made support plan.

Our young people have complex needs, including extremely challenging behaviour. Some can also be violent which is caused by very negative and traumatic childhoods.

Due to this, the job role can be very volatile. You must be comfortable working in an environment which can change suddenly and unexpectedly. Strong physical and emotional resilience, excellent communication skills, and the capacity to de-escalate potentially volatile situations is key. Prior experience in a similar role or relevant training in physical restraint techniques is highly desirable.

Things for you to consider before applying:

  • Although we advertise our roles in specific areas, you could be asked to work anywhere in the Northeast. Due to this, you must be comfortable with travelling and often staying away from home during your shift pattern.
  • A full UK manual driving license is required for all our Support Workers.
  • To ensure consistency, our shift patterns revolve around rolling 4 shifts on and 4 shifts off. These include a combination of 12-hour day and waking night shifts, of which the day shifts are regularly followed by sleeping nights, for which you are awarded an enhanced shift allowance. Rotas are designed to meet the needs of our young people, so we all apply a flexible approach to ensure we can provide the very best care possible.

Requirements

Our Support Workers will have:

  • Ideally at least 12 months employed experience working with vulnerable young people, but open to considering other relevant and transferable employed or lived experience.
  • The ability to remain calm and non-judgemental whilst working with behaviours and needs such as absconding, self-harm, sexualised behaviour, attachment disorder, trauma and criminalisation.
  • A genuine passion for delivering the highest standard of care to vulnerable individuals.
  • Sound knowledge of safeguarding policies.
  • Understanding of CQC and OFSTED regulations and their importance.
  • A full UK manual driving license and are happy and comfortable travelling for work.
  • Full right to work in the UK.
  • Ideally NVQ Level 3 in Residential Childcare, however for the right candidate we would be happy to support them obtaining this qualification.
